RWA hosts staff exhibition: ‘Also Artists’
The Royal West of England Academy (RWA) has launched an exhibition with a difference, celebrating the many hidden talents within the organisation.
Also Artists: A Staff Exhibition includes over 80 pieces made by 43 members of staff, including drawing school tutors, members of the front-of-house team and freelancers.
“Beyond offering our dedicated staff the opportunity to display their artwork in a professional gallery environment,” says the RWA, “this exhibition has opened doors for members of the Visitor Experience team to gain insights into different organisational roles and acquire valuable skills that will shape their careers in the cultural sector.”

The collection was the brainchild of Steph Garratt, a RWA marketing assistant who proposed the idea in January and has been project manager for the duration.
The chosen lead image for the exhibition comes from marketing manager, Hemali Modha, who has contributed three pieces to Also Artists.

“The exhibition is a great way to show the diversity of staff within the RWA,” she says. “There is so much expertise that staff members can share, equally staff feel that their skills as artists have been acknowledged and celebrated.”
Many of the artworks in the exhibition are available to purchase.

Also Artists: A Staff Exhibition is at the RWA until January 7 2024 at 10am-5pm Tuesday-Sunday; closed Monday (except for Bank Holidays). It is free to attend.
